Which organic molecule is responsible for the insulation of internal organs against shock?

Answer:

The correct answer would be B. lipids.

Lipids are organic compounds which are insoluble in polar solvents such as water and are soluble in non-polar solvent such as ether.

They are essential for proper functioning of the body.

They serve various functions such as:

Energy storage: Excess of food we eat is converted into fats and is stored in adipose tissues. They serve as the source of energy when levels of glucose are low in the blood.

Insulation: Lipids helps in maintaining the constant internal temperature of the body. Subcutaneous fats serve as the blanket layer around the tissue which aids in insulating the body against external temperatures. Triglycerides are mainly involved in thermal insulation and sphingolipids are mainly involved in electrical insulation.

Protection: Visceral fat (layer of fat around the internal organs) act like bubble wrap around the internal organs and protect them from injury, trauma or shock.

Other functions may include structural component (plasma membrane), hormonal roles (such as steroidal hormones), absorption of fat-soluble vitamins et cetera.

How would seasons on Earth differ if Earth's axis was at a 90 degree angle relative to its orbit?
Triss [41]

Answer:

There would be no seasons anywhere on Earth

Explanation:

If the Earth's axis was not tilting and it was at a 90 degrees angle relative to its orbit, then the seasons on Earth would disappear. The climate on the planet would be defined by the latitude. The equator and the areas close to it would always have summer, as they will receive direct sunlight throughout all of the year. The mid-latitudes will always have temperate climate, reminding of spring and autumn, as the sunlight will not be very direct, but it will also not be very dispersed, jut enough to create a constantly pleasant climate. The higher latitudes will always have winter, as the sunlight will come at a very low angle throughout all of the year, thus it will be very dispersed, not enough to ever warm this parts enough, so they will constantly be under ice.
